Sawmill Timber Production Manager

Careers Profile
You know how a saw mill operates, green mill, dry mill and re-man. You'll have experience in at least some facets of the business, whether on the production or professional sides.
You'll be ready to lead the mill team in maximising the value of the logs by producing quality product to environmental standards. You'll also be responsible for staffing – including HR and dispute resolution.
You'll set and achieve production targets and budgets – and probably be on call 24/7.
You'll also have the satisfaction of knowing that you're making a difference because you’re producing one of the world's most environmentally friendly building materials – sustainably sourced timber.
Role
As a Timber Production Manager you could do a wide range of tasks including:
- Managing people
- Problem solving
- Meeting production targets and budgets
- Client liaison
- Writing and submitting reports
- Production planning
- Plant maintenance and upgrade planning.

Ideal Attributes
You'll enjoy senior management in a team environment, be a good communicator, be interested in the timber you are producing and understand the value of the product you are handling.
You will always put your safety and that of your people first.
Qualifications
You will have experience in working in a mill environment and have Certificate IV, diploma or degree qualifications.
Employers in the forest and wood products industry are very supportive of ongoing training and skills development.
